According to KDVR, the dust is making its way toward Colorado. But, you know how the weather is... We're not exactly sure if the Saharan dust will make it to our state or not until it is actually here.

The best part about the Saharan dust is that they can make for some amazing sunsets that will have brighter shades of red, orange, pink, and yellow. On the opposite side of the spectrum, air quality degradation is pretty bad. Especially for those with preexisting conditions such as heart disease, lung disease, asthma, or allergies.
